Overview
Permutations and Combinations are fundamental counting techniques in mathematics that help solve complex counting problems systematically. Learning Objectives
- Master the fundamental principles of counting: Addition, Multiplication, and Invariance principles
- Understand and apply factorial notation in various mathematical contexts
- Distinguish between permutations and combinations based on problem requirements
- Calculate permutations of distinct objects, identical objects, and circular arrangements
- Solve combination problems involving selections from groups
